Taking place in Beijing, on September 9, 2025, this half-day event aims to bring together like-minded professionals who play a crucial role in planning and coordinating professional development.
In this half-day session, we will explore the complex relationship between professional development (PD) and teacher appraisal. While both aim to enhance educator effectiveness, the balance between fostering growth and evaluating performance can often be tricky to navigate.

Essential Question – How can we ensure that PD remains a tool for genuine professional growth, rather than becoming entangled in performance assessments?

This event will focus on understanding where to draw the line between development and evaluation, where to leverage PD to drive improvement, and where it’s essential to maintain clear boundaries. Through discussion and real-life examples, participants will examine strategies for fostering a culture of growth without compromising the integrity of PD initiatives.
